周期執行個體是周期任務按照調度配置自動定時運行產生的執行個體。周期任務每調度一次,便產生一個執行個體。同時,可以對已產生的執行個體進行營運管理,例如查看運行狀態、重跑和查看節點代碼等操作。本文將介紹周期執行個體的通用功能。
周期執行個體產生時間及運行規則
Dataphin每晚23點產生次日需要啟動並執行周期執行個體,產生的執行個體預設是未運行狀態。
周期執行個體依賴的上遊執行個體全部運行成功後,周期執行個體的狀態從未運行變成等待調度時間。
當到達當前執行個體的定時已耗用時間,且Dataphin剩餘可用調度資源充足、並通過所有命中的限流規則校正後,周期執行個體的狀態會從等待調度時間變成運行中。
說明暫停執行個體即暫停當前周期執行個體的運行,不影響該任務其他周期產生的執行個體運行。如果需要暫停多個周期執行個體的運行,可以將該任務的調度屬性修改為暫停調度,詳情請參見管理整合和計算任務。
周期執行個體頁面入口
在Dataphin首頁的頂部功能表列,選擇研發 > 任務營運。
在頂部功能表列中選擇生產或開發環境。
在左側導覽列中選擇執行個體營運 > 周期執行個體。
周期執行個體頁面介紹
周期執行個體頁面主要展示整合和計算任務列表以及建模任務列表,可在周期執行個體頁面對提交的周期執行個體進行相關的營運操作。

區塊 | 說明 |
①搜尋及篩選區域 | 支援通過輸入節點ID或節點名稱來搜尋周期執行個體,適用於知曉節點ID或節點名稱時進行快捷搜尋出所需的周期執行個體。
|
②周期執行個體列表 | 周期執行個體頁面以列表形式,展示目前使用者擁有營運-訪問目錄許可權的專案下所有的周期任務,分為整合和計算任務以及建模任務,列表操作欄為您展示周期執行個體支援的營運管理操作,各周期執行個體類型所支援的營運操作詳情如下:
|
③大量操作 | 可通過大量操作地區提供的重跑、終止、置成功繼續調度、暫停、恢複、修改調度資源群組和修改優先順序功能,對周期執行個體進行批量處理,提高操作效率。
|
④時區轉換 | 當租戶的調度時區和系統時區(即使用者中心中展示的時區)不一致時,可通過時區轉換,分別查看調度時區或系統時區下的定時已耗用時間、開始已耗用時間和結束已耗用時間。 說明 篩選中的開始已耗用時間、結束時間和定時間,僅支援採用系統時區的時間進行篩選。 |
周期執行個體提示標記說明
標記 | 提示 | 描述 |
| 延遲 | 已開啟資料延遲的事件事實邏輯表,在周期執行個體運行成功後, Dataphin檢測到資料延遲時, 將提示該標記。 |
| 空跑 | 該周期執行個體任務的調度屬性設定為空白跑調度。 |
| 暫停 | 該周期執行個體任務的調度屬性設定為暫停調度。 |
周期執行個體運行狀態說明
狀態標識 | 運行狀態 | 描述 |
| 未運行 | 未開始啟動並執行執行個體。 |
| 等待調度資源 | 依賴的所有上遊節點已經運行成功,等待調度資源。 |
| 限流中 | 限流中的執行個體。 |
| 等待調度時間 | 依賴的所有上遊節點已經運行成功,等待到達調度時間。 |
| 運行中 | 正在運行中的執行個體。 |
| 失敗 | 運行失敗的執行個體。 如果終止等待中或運行中狀態的執行個體,則執行個體狀態變更為失敗。 |
| 成功 | 運行成功的執行個體。 空跑調度的執行個體系統會直接標記為運行成功。 |
周期執行個體DAG圖
單擊周期執行個體巨集指令清單的執行個體對象名稱,頁面右側將展示以當前節點為中心節點的DAG圖。DAG圖支援可視化動態呈現該節點的上下遊依賴關係,預設展示Main節點(選中節點)及上下遊第一層節點。如果即時執行個體沒有上下遊節點,則DAG圖僅展示當前Main節點。同時系統支援對上下遊節點進行營運和管理。
支援調整DAG圖頁面範圍:
單擊
表徵圖,隱藏即時執行個體列表,放大DAG圖。單擊
表徵圖,隱藏DAG圖。滑鼠移至上方至
表徵圖拖動,以擴大或縮小DAG圖的頁面範圍。
建模任務執行個體DAG圖與整合和計算任務執行個體DAG圖介面資訊相同,下圖以整合和計算任務執行個體為例:

區塊 | 說明 |
①節點資訊 | 展示當前選中節點的概要資訊。單擊查看節點詳情,可以查看更多節點資訊,包括執行個體機率、運行診斷、作業記錄、動作記錄、節點代碼和任務參數等。
整合和計算任務執行個體:包括執行個體概覽、運行診斷、作業記錄、動作記錄、節點代碼。 建模任務執行個體:包括執行個體概覽、運行診斷、作業記錄、動作記錄、物化代碼。 |
②節點篩選區域 | 快捷設定以Main節點為中心向上向下的展開層級。當展開節點較多不便查看時,可以搜尋節點名稱以快速定位當前DAG圖展示範圍內的某個節點。 |
③調度依賴關係圖 | 展示執行個體的調度依賴關係圖,支援向上向下展開更多節點,同時支援對上下遊節點的營運操作。滑鼠移至上方至DAG節點上,可以查看該節點的名稱、類型、調度周期、營運負責人及其描述資訊。
|
④畫布調整區 | 快捷調整DAG顯示比例,包括設定顯示比例(預設為100%)、在當前比例基礎上放大(最大200%)、在當前比例基礎上縮小(最小20%)、適應畫布和全屏展示。同時,展示當前DAG圖中Main節點的節點ID和節點名稱。 |
⑤執行個體對象列表 | 查看DAG圖時,執行個體對象列表將展示執行個體對象的名稱和業務日期。滑鼠指標至執行個體對象,將展示當前對象的節點名、節點ID、調度周期、業務日期、定時已耗用時間。如下圖所示: |
